Cruz Beckham takes fresh dig at Brooklyn Beckham – hours after his loved-up appearance with Nicola

Cruz Beckham appeared to take a new swipe at his older brother Brooklyn on Saturday – just hours after Brooklyn made a smitten red carpet outing with his wife Nicola Peltz.

Brooklyn, 27, and Nicola, 31, packed on the PDA as they enjoyed a glamorous night out in Venice on Friday. The couple travelled to the Italian city so Nicole could receive the Rising Star Award at the Kinéo Awards — an independent ceremony that coincides with the Venice Film Festival – the following day.

But ahead of the main event, Brooklyn proudly escorted his wife to the Golden Globes X Aman Beverly Hills cocktail party, and they looked utterly smitten as they posed for photographers. 

The following morning, Cruz took to Instagram with a pointed new post.

It showed the budding musician together with the rest of the Beckham clan – including Cruz’s girlfriend Jackie Apostel, 30, and Romeo’s partner, 24-year-old Kim Turnbull.

Cruz, 21, simply captioned the image with a red love heart.

It’s been a big summer for Cruz, who performed at both Reading and Leeds Festival with his band, The Breakers. His family were out in force to support him at his appearance in Berkshire – and the singer later took to Instagram to reflect on his milestone. 

Sharing a series of photos from the weekend, he wrote: “I am so grateful for everyone around me, not only are they my best friends but they are family, this journey has been so incredible and I have learned so much because of these people.

“Last but definitely not least Jackie, you honestly have no idea how lucky we are to have you, not only do you take care of me but this whole operation, from creative to strategy to mgmt. We are a team and would not be doing this without you. I really love you so much.”

Nicola’s big night

Nicola was not only supported by Brooklyn as she accepted her Rising Star award on Saturday night – her proud billionaire father, businessman Nelson Peltz, mother Claudia, and brother Bradley were also there, cheering her on.

Wearing an elegant, full-length black dress, Nicola paid tribute to her loved ones as she took to the podium in the gardens of the Casa Cinema Giovani.

“Hi everyone. I am normally more comfortable playing a character as an actor than standing in front of an audience, so please bear with me,” she told the audience, via the Daily Mail. “Thank you so much for this immense honour. To receive an award at the Venice Film Festival is something I will carry with me for the rest of my career.”

She continued: “My family are my everything. My mum, dad, (brothers) Diesel and Brad and Brooklyn thank you. You always believe in me. To have your support is the reason I can reach to the stars in the first place.”

Nicola recently wrote, directed, and starred in self-funded movie Lola, whilst her resumé also includes roles in The Last Airbender, Transformers: Age of Extinction, Bates Motel, Holidate, Welcome to Chippendales and The Beauty.

She was named ‘Rising Star’ despite the fact that she started acting some 20 years ago, starring in Deck the Halls with Danny DeVito, in 2006, aged 11. But as the Kineo Awards noted, “in recent years, the American actress, screenwriter and producer has attracted growing international attention through increasingly multifaceted roles, both in front of and behind the camera”.  

Nicola was honoured alongside icon Faye Dunaway, who co-stars in her new self-funded film Prima. The legendary actress received a lifetime achievement award.

Hours later, the couple once again hit the red carpet, as they posed together ahead of the It Will Happen Tonight screening at the 83rd Venice International Film Festival.

The feud rumbles on

Brooklyn’s estrangement from his famous family came to a head in January when he shared a bombshell 800-word statement following months of speculation. Since then, he has been all but estranged from his famous family and has expressed his desire not to “reconcile” with them, after accusing them of trying to “ruin” his relationship with Nicola.

The latest instalment in the feud came last month when Brooklyn unveiled his fully covered “mamma’s boy” tattoo, which he originally had in honour of his famous mum. 

Brooklyn’s new body art is reported to be a drawing of his wife’s bridal bouquet from their wedding in 2022. 

Brooklyn, 26, previously had ‘DAD’ inscribed within an anchor design on his upper right arm, along with the message ‘Love you Bust’ beneath – in reference to David’s nickname for his firstborn. However, he appears to have had the inked tribute covered up so that it is virtually indiscernible.

The accusations

In his six-page Instagram statement in January, Brooklyn made clear that relations with his parents had broken down, saying he had been forced to respond after they had “continued to go to the press”.

He made claims including that his mother had “cancelled making Nicola’s [wedding] dress at the eleventh hour” and “danced very inappropriately on me in front of everyone” during the ceremony.

He also claimed his family values “public promotion and endorsements above all else”, adding that “family ‘love’ is decided by how much you post on social media, or how quickly you drop everything to show up and pose for a family photo opp”.
